The Shocking Blue on Colossus Records


Shocking Blue - sometimes referred to as The Shock Blue - was a Dutch rock band from The Hague, the Netherlands, formed in 1967.  Their biggest hit, "Venus", went to #1 on the Billboard Hot 100 in February 1970, and the band had sold 13.5 million discs by 1973, but the group disbanded in 1974.  They look sort of like an ABBA precursor.
